是否有一种标准的方法让事务侦听事件或其他事务,并在满足条件时(即特定事件发生)运行事务代码。
只在收到钱的时候才卖房子,收到钱是另一回事。
还是一个简单的民意测验,设置一个外部服务的警报,该服务正在监听频道的事件?这里有标准的方法吗?
发布于 2018-06-04 11:50:04
如果事务将PropertyListing资产(使用其ID)更新为PAYMENT_RECEIVED (例如。卖方的律师已收到代管财产交易的款项,因此,当一方提交交易以表明这一点时,房屋资产可以自动更新为“出售”,并发布客户应用程序监听的事件。
PropertyListing
PAYMENT_RECEIVED
然后,客户端应用程序可以启动流程中的下一个步骤,例如转让所有权等协议(无论在用例中如何完成,都可能是另一个显示“验收”手册或自动操作的事务)。我说“客户端应用程序”,是因为我假设有一定程度的用户交互,可以将其作为协议的一种方式。
请参阅有关events 这里和订阅events 这里的更多信息。
https://stackoverflow.com/questions/50663157
相似问题